UK-SuSCL Summary, etc: In considering the ideological repercussions of references to Italy in prominent works by Shakespeare and his contemporaries, Michael J. Redmond argues that early modern intertextuality was a dynamic process of allusion, quotation and revision. Target audience: Specialized.
